NePO: Neural Point Octrees for Large‐Scale Novel View Synthesis

open access: yesComputer Graphics Forum, EarlyView.
We introduce Neural Point Octrees (NePOs), a scalable radiance field representation that organises point clouds hierarchically for efficient optimisation and rendering of large scale scenes. NePOs enable level of detail selection, joint refinement of appearance and camera poses, and real‐time rendering of hundreds of millions of points.

NeRF-XL: Scaling NeRFs with Multiple GPUs

open access: yes
We present NeRF-XL, a principled method for distributing Neural Radiance Fields (NeRFs) across multiple GPUs, thus enabling the training and rendering of NeRFs with an arbitrarily large capacity. Style Brush: Guided Style Transfer for 3D Objects

open access: yesComputer Graphics Forum, EarlyView.
We introduce Style Brush, a guided 3D style‐transfer method for textured meshes that provides precise creative control. It supports the use of multiple style images, smooth transitions and intuitive guidance, producing visually appealing textures that follow user intent as we demonstrate in our user study and results.
